The Journey of Rasmus Kofoed: A Culinary Maestro

©Claes Bech-Poulsen

Rasmus Kofoed, a native of Denmark, is the visionary behind Geranium. His culinary journey began in his mother's kitchen, where he developed a love for nature, vegetables, and cooking. Over the years, Kofoed's passion for cooking led him to become the captain of the Danish culinary team and a Bocuse d'Or champion. In 2007, he opened Geranium, which quickly garnered Michelin stars and acclaim for its celebration of seasonal, organic, and biodynamic ingredients.

The Universe Tasting Menu: A Gastronomic Symphony

The heart of Geranium's culinary experience is the 'Universe' tasting menu, a seasonally-changing extravaganza that unfolds over a minimum of three hours. With around 20 meticulously crafted courses, this menu is a harmonious blend of appetizers, savory dishes, and sweets. Every dish is an intricate work of art, served on nature-inspired crockery.

In 2022, Geranium reached the zenith of its culinary journey by being named The World's Best Restaurant, sponsored by S.Pellegrino & Acqua Panna, a testament to its commitment to innovation and excellence.

A Meatless Paradise: Nature on the Plate

In 2022, Geranium made a bold and sustainable move by becoming a meat-free zone. Instead, the focus shifted solely to local seafood and vegetables sourced from organic and biodynamic farms in Denmark and Scandinavia. This commitment to sustainability is evident in dishes like lightly smoked lumpfish roe with milk, kale, and apple, as well as forest mushrooms with beer, smoked egg yolk, pickled hops, and rye bread.

Masters of Hospitality: Warmth and Excellence

Geranium isn't just about food; it's about hospitality at its finest. Co-owner Søren Ledet is a natural-born people-person, charming host, and outstanding sommelier. He welcomes each guest like family, making them feel at home throughout their meal. The restaurant's warm service style and constantly evolving drinks program earned Geranium the prestigious Art of Hospitality Award in 2018.

Scandinavian Elegance: A Dining Experience Like No Other

The dining room at Geranium is a spacious, light-filled haven with direct access to the open kitchen, offering a glimpse into the culinary magic as it unfolds. For special occasions, guests can request the fireplace table, which overlooks the park, or opt for the larger private dining room in the Inspiration Kitchen. The restaurant's decor features open fires, blonde wood, and modern Scandinavian design, creating a truly world-leading setting for the world's leading restaurant.
